The Art of Mash Preparation



Mash prep work in craft distillery manufacturing is a precise process that lays the foundation for the high quality and taste profile of the last distilled spirits. The art of mash preparation involves incorporating grains such as barley, corn, rye, or wheat with water and enzymes to convert the starches right into fermentable sugars. This essential step needs accuracy in the selection of grains, water quality, and enzyme activity to make certain ideal sugar extraction throughout fermentation.


Craft distilleries take wonderful care in sourcing high-grade grains as they directly impact the preference and personality of the spirits. The proportions of various grains used in the mash costs are likewise very carefully computed to accomplish the desired flavor account. In addition, aspects such as water temperature level, pH degrees, and blending strategies play a significant role in the mashing procedure.




Once the mash is prepared, it goes through fermentation, where yeast is contributed to convert sugars right into alcohol. The quality of the mash directly influences the performance of fermentation and inevitably, the overall top quality of the distilled spirits. Craft distilleries pride themselves on their interest to information during mash prep work, identifying its importance in producing remarkable spirits.


Fermentation: Changing Ingredients Into Alcohol



How do craft distilleries change very carefully ready active ingredients right into alcohol with the procedure of fermentation? Fermentation is an important action in craft distillery production where yeast connects with sugars to develop alcohol.

During fermentation, the temperature level and atmosphere are very closely kept an eye on to guarantee ideal problems for yeast task. This procedure commonly takes several days to a week, relying on the desired alcohol content and flavor account. As the yeast works its magic, the liquid goes through substantial chemical modifications, leading to the formation of alcohol.


Once fermentation is complete, the resulting fluid is referred to as the clean or beer. This alcoholic liquid functions as the structure for the subsequent distillation process, where it will be transformed into the final spirit through cautious craftsmanship and precision techniques.


Purification Methods and Equipment



Using customized equipment and accurate methods, craft distilleries employ numerous purification methods to extract and refine the alcohol web content of the fermented clean, ultimately forming the personality and high quality of the last spirit. Purification is the procedure of separating alcohol webpage from the fermented liquid via dissipation and condensation. Craft distilleries typically use pot stills, column stills, or hybrid stills in their distillation procedures. Pot stills, including a pot and a swan neck, are known for creating flavorful spirits with rich appearances. On the other hand, column stills, which have multiple plates for distillation, are favored for creating lighter and smoother spirits. Hybrid stills combine components of both pot and column stills, providing distillers versatility in crafting a varied array of spirits. The option of still and the purification method made use of dramatically influence the scent, flavor, and general quality of the distilled spirit. Craft distillers commonly try out different tools arrangements and purification methods to attain outstanding and one-of-a-kind spirits that mirror their imagination and expertise.




Aging Process: From Barrel to Bottle



With the distilled spirits now prepared, the focus moves in the direction of the critical point of the aging procedure, where the change from barrel to bottle imbues the fluid with distinct flavors and attributes. Aging plays a critical duty in the growth of the spirit, as it communicates with the timber of the barrels. The choice of barrel type, whether oak, charred, or previously made use of for various other spirits, greatly affects the final preference profile. Throughout aging, the spirit goes through a complicated series of chain reactions that enhance its preference, color, and scent.

Temperature level changes and the environment where the barrels are stored also effect aging, as they influence the rate at which the spirit communicates with the wood. Distillers meticulously monitor these variables to ensure that the spirit reaches its ideal growth prior to being bottled and delighted in by customers.


Bottling and Identifying: Last Touches



Upon conclusion of the aging procedure, the craft distillery meticulously proceeds with the meticulous tasks of identifying and bottling, adding the final touches that will offer the spirit to customers. Bottling is an essential step that calls for accuracy to make certain consistency in each bottle. Craft distilleries typically utilize automated bottling lines outfitted with machinery such as labelers, cappers, and fillers to streamline the process. These devices aid maintain efficiency while maintaining quality criteria.


Classifying is an additional necessary element of the bottling procedure. Distilleries pay close attention to label design, guaranteeing it abides by regulative requirements while additionally conveying the brand's identification. Tags typically include crucial information like the spirit's name, alcohol material, and beginning. Additionally, some craft distilleries hand-label their bottles for an individualized touch, particularly for limited version launches.
